Location Reviews
GameStop reviews reflect a mixed sentiment, with both positive and negative experiences reported. Positives include praise for helpful and energetic employees, such as mentions of specific staff members like Jessie and Ozzy, who provided exceptional customer service. The availability of used games and merchandise at competitive prices is also frequently highlighted as a benefit. However, many reviews express dissatisfaction with the condition of products, particularly damaged or defective items (e.g., Funko Pops, figurines, and games) that were not discounted or repaired. Customers also report poor customer service, including unhelpful or rude staff, complicated return processes, and inconsistent policies (e.g., short return windows or refusal to accept defective items).
Common negatives include complaints about online ordering issues, such as delayed or incorrect deliveries, non-functional products, and a poorly designed website with bugs and delivery errors. Some reviewers criticize GameStop’s handling of pre-orders, with lost or untraceable items and lack of compensation for delays. While a few stores and employees receive specific praise, overall sentiment leans toward disappointment, with many customers expressing frustration over inconsistent product quality, unresponsive customer service, and a decline in the company’s reputation.
The reviews emphasize a disparity between individual store experiences and broader systemic issues, such as false advertising, extended wait times, and a lack of accountability for errors. While some customers remain loyal due to the value of used games and occasional positive interactions, the majority of feedback underscores recurring problems with product quality, service reliability, and return policies, contributing to a generally negative perception of the brand.
